Dance Hall (1941)
BEAUTIFUL...but not dumb! She taught this dance-hall king a new technique in love!
Singer Lili Brown is attracted to dance hall manager Duke till she realizes he does that to all the girls. Nice guy Duke sets her up with composer Joe Brooks.
Director: Irving Pichel
Genre: Comedy, Romance, Music
Runtime: 73 min
Release Date: July 18, 1941
Cast
- Carole Landis - Lili Brown
- Cesar Romero - Duke McKay
- William Henry - Joe Brooks
- June Storey - Ada
- J. Edward Bromberg - Max Brandon
- Charles Halton - Mr. Frederick Newmeyer
- Shimen Ruskin - Charles 'Limpy' Larkin
- William Haade - Moon
- Trudi Marsdon - Vivian
- Russ Clark - Cook
Production: 20th Century Fox
Country: United States of America
Original Language: en
